The history of the edison bulb dates back to the late 19th century when Thomas Edison and his team worked tirelessly to create a lasting and practical electric lighting source. In 1879, Edison’s team finally achieved success with the invention of a carbon filament bulb. This innovation sparked a revolution, illuminating countless homes and businesses around the world. The Edison bulb, with its distinctive design featuring a visible filament within a clear glass envelope, quickly became an iconic symbol of progress and innovation.

In terms of energy efficiency, it’s true that Edison bulbs may not compare to their modern LED counterparts. However, their unique charm and aesthetic value make them a worthwhile investment for many. Many homeowners and designers are willing to sacrifice a bit of energy efficiency for the timeless elegance and warm ambiance that Edison bulbs bring to a space. Additionally, advancements in technology have resulted in the development of energy-efficient Edison-style LED bulbs that closely mimic the look of traditional Edison bulbs while consuming much less power.
